Meigs Wins, Whitwell Loses In Class A State Softball

Ashley Rogers Tosses Perfect Game As Defending Champs Roll, 9-0

MURFREESBORO -- Tuesday was a good day for the Meigs County softball team, but not so good for the young ladies from Whitwell.

The defending Class A champions from Decatur got another perfect game from junior Ashley Rogers and rolled to a 9-0 victory over Jackson Christian while the Whitwell Lady Tigers came out on the short end of a 5-1 final against Forrest.

While Rogers was doing her usual thing for Meigs, she was also the hitting star as she collected three of her team's 14 hits and had three runs batted in, including a solo homer in the sixth.

Teammate Madison Crabtree also had three hits and two runs batted in on homer in the third inning.

Rogers finished the game with 16 strikeouts.

The Lady Rockets scored two runs in the fourth inning and put things away with three more in the seventh while Whitwell's only run came on a single by Carley Terry in the seventh inning.

Forrest finished with 10 hits while the Lady Tigers were limited to just seven, including two from losing pitcher Anna Yell.

Other Whitwell hits came from Camryn Haag, Raylon Smith, Layla McEwen and Caitlyn Rollins.

Whitwell is scheduled to face Jackson Christian on Wednesday at 11:30 while Meigs County will face Forrest on Wednesday at 5:30.

FORREST  000 200 3 -- 5 10 0

WHITWELL  000 000 1 -- 1 7 3

 

MEIGS CO.  004 113 0 -- 9 14 1

JACKSON CHRISTIAN  000 000 0 -- 0 0 1
